REGRESSION (r204601): Many new flaky timeouts started on 8/18/16

There have been a large number of flaky tests that all started timing out around 8/18/16.

This is very likely caused by <http://trac.webkit.org/r204601>, even though there is no obvious relationship to the failing tests. The failures are rare, but cross-referencing multiple tests and multiple bots, I found that there are no timeouts on these before r204601, and then there are 2-3 failures for each revision. The timeout happens in the same worker that ran hls/hls-accessiblity-describes-video-menu.html, only 2-3 minutes later.

Ryan skipped hls/hls-accessiblity-describes-video-menu.html in r205124 to see if it helps.

Well, that did it. Still a mystery why this test causes timeouts later.
